Coatings drying system with STIR® technology shortened by 75 %

Three new coating drying systems show the successful cooperation in development of the IBT with a renowned German plant manufacturer. Not only could the length of the system be shortened by 75 %, compared to the old system the electric connected load was reduced by 50 %.

The drying task comprises the exact pre-drying of aqueous 1K and 2K coating systems. For that STIR® emitters are implemented in a particular compact machine unit that provides consistent drying results under all climatic conditions.

Short-wave radiators often heat the core of the substrate too much which subsequently leads to various surface defects and component deformations during the varnish hardening. In opposite to that the infrared is absorbed almost exclusively by the varnish when using medium-wave STIR® emitters. This results in a better and faster drying of the coating. The substrate is heated less; component deformations and the subsequent development of surface defects, e. g. because of out-gassing of the substrate, are avoided.
